Meditation is the art of cultivating awareness, especially awareness of the Self and inner world. Awareness is the most fundamental aspect of being, therefore the most invisible. To see what is always here, we must spend some time in stillness and silence.

Inquiry is the art of asking the right questions and following what we discover in such a way that yields true revelation and transformation.

Integrity is the art of showing up fully for the values and truths we have discovered along the way. It is the capacity to move with the whole body, heart and mind in alignment.
